>>> Hi, I update it to webkitgtk-2.4.9, apply and modify your patch, end with:
>>>
>>> * webkitgtk
>>>   Unmodified, for upstream 'stable' release.
>>>   GTK3 port with only WebKit2 API.
>>>
>>> * webkitgtk-2.4
>>>   Last version with WebKit1 API support (also with WebKit2), GTK3 port.
>>>    
>>> * webkitgtk/gtk+-2
>>>   Last GTK2 port, only support WebKit1 API.
>>>
>>
>> Good job, but after i build emacs-xwidget with webkitgtk-2.4, it can't
>> open "https://..." ssl url, I don't know the reason, is it the
>> webkitgtk's problem? How to test it?
> webkitgtk based applications use glib-networking to handle 'https',
> it's a gio module and used at the runtime.
> try:
>
>   $ guix package -i glib-networking
>   $ GIO_EXTRA_MODULES=$HOME/.guix-profile/lib/gio/modules emacs

Should we arrange so that webkitgtk always adds glib-networking to its
set of GIO modules?
